Description

Lóni who entered Moria with Balin, Frár, Óin, Ori, Flói, and Náli in their attempt to form a colony there in TA 2989. Lóni was killed in a battle while defending the Bridge of Khazad-dûm and Second Hall alongside Náli and Frár. His body fell thousands of feet off the bridge of Khazad-dum, but his axe was recovered.
His story is told in the Book of Mazarbul, which was found by Gandalf when he and the Fellowship passed through Moria during their travels.
